参数的调用有两种方式: 1、期望参数的使用。 2、实际传递参数的使用。 需要注意的是: 1.arguments是一个object对象,它不是数组,不能对它使用shift、push、join等方法。 2.上述举例时用的arguments[i]中 ...
JS函数的参数在function内可以用arguments对象来获取。参数的调用有两种方式: 期望参数的使用。 实际传递参数的使用。应用举例:function Test a, b var i, s Test函数有 var numargs arguments.length 获取实际被传递参数的数值。var expargs Test.length 获取期望参数的数值,函数定义时的预期参数个数 有a和b ...
2016-07-23 09:19 0 13502 推荐指数:
参数的调用有两种方式: 1、期望参数的使用。 2、实际传递参数的使用。 需要注意的是: 1.arguments是一个object对象,它不是数组,不能对它使用shift、push、join等方法。 2.上述举例时用的arguments[i]中 ...
知识点: JavaScript 函数对参数的值(arguments)没有进行任何的检查。 JavaScript 函数参数与大多数其他语言的函数参数的区别在于:它不会关注有多少个参数被传递,不关注传递的参数的数据类型。 参数规则: JavaScript 函数定义时参数没有指定 ...
arguments Description 在所有的函数中有一个arguments对象,arguments对象指向函数的参数,arguments object is an Array-like object,除了length,不具备数组的其他属性。 访问: var ...
原文地址:js参数arguments的理解 对于函数的参数而言,如下例子 function say(name, msg){ alert(name + 'say' + msg); } say('xiao', 'hello'); 当调用 ...
JS与PHP在函数传参方面有点不同,PHP形参与实参个数要匹配,而JS就灵活多了,可以随意传参,实参比形参少或多都不会报错。 实参比形参多不会报错 ? 1 2 3 ...
arguments argument是JavaScript中的一个关键字,用于指向调用者传入的所有参数。 即使不定义参数,也可以取到调用者的参数。 REST 由于JavaScript函数允许接收任意个参数,所以不得不用arguments来获取函数定义a以外 ...
JavaScript用function关键字声明函数,可以用return返回值,也可以没有返回值。 建议:要么统一有返回值,要么统一都没有返回值,这样调试代码方便。 函数定义格式: function functionName(参数){ //函数 ...
归纳起来,Python中函数的定义形式和调用形式主要有如下几种形式: 这里需要注意3点: 1 在Python 2.X中(在Python 3.X中,这种形式已经不允许了),还有一种定义函数的方式,就是将函数的参数定义成一个tuple,那么,当调用函数的时候,传递一个结构一样 ...